How to make a yummy Brown Sugar Oatmilk Cortado! Very simple with a few steps. Small but packed with caffeine for the go! Cortados come in one small size, perfect for busy mornings.

Supplies

IMG_3710.jpg

For this beverage, you will need:

  1. Blonde Ristetto Espresso
  2. Oatmilk
  3. Cinnamon Powder
  4. Brown Sugar Syrup
  5. Milk Steamer
  6. Mug


Queue Shots

IMG_3711.jpg

The first step in handcrafting this drink will be to queue your 3 Blonde Ristretto Espresso shots. This usually takes the longest to complete, 60-90 seconds.

Steam the Milk

IMG_3712.jpg

The second step is where you begin steaming your milk, customizable to your preferred temperature. Aerate between 3-5 seconds for the perfect froth.

Pump Brown Sugar Syrup

OIP (6).jpeg

The third step involves the flavored syrup. While we wait for the shots to pull and milk to steam, pump brown sugar into an empty mug. This recipe calls for two full pumps. Add extra for more sweetness!

Back to Espresso

IMG_3713.jpg

In the fourth step, you will make sure the shots are pulling correctly. Good shots will have a distinct body and cream layer. Blonde Espresso calls for a smoother, more energetic experience. This specific machine will show a star for good espresso quality.

Add Cinnamon

IMG_3714.jpg

Almost done! Now we will add a layer of cinnamon to the drink before pouring the milk. This allows the cinnamon to settle in with the espresso.

Top It Off

IMG_3715.jpg

Last Step! Top the beverage off with the steamed oatmilk or milk of choice. Add a thin layer of cinnamon to the foam for taste.
